Dgellabæ'anThe Persian era. Dgella Eddin, son of Togrul Beg, appointed eight astronomers to reform the calendar. The era began A.D. 1075, and is followed to this day. Source: Dictionary of Phrase and Fable, E. Cobham Brewer, 1894
